Time Lag Test

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2005 Mazda MX-5 Miata.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Perform mechanical system test preparation. (See MECHANICAL SYSTEM TEST PREPARATION .)
  2. Shift the selector lever from the N position to D range. (O/D OFF switch OFF)
  3. Use a stopwatch to measure the time it takes from shifting until engagement is felt. Make three measurements for each test and take the average from the results.
  4. Perform the test for the following shifts in the same manner.
    1. N position --> D range (O/D OFF SW ON)
    2. N position --> R position

    Time lag 

    1. N position --> D range: 0.7 sec. 
    2. N position --> R position: 1.2 sec. 
    EVALUATION OF TIME LAG TEST

    Condition Possible cause
    N --> D select Insufficient line pressure
    Forward clutch slipping
    One-way clutch NO.2 slipping
    N --> R select Insufficient line pressure
    Direct clutch slipping
    Reverse brake slipping
